The Blood Collection Tubes Market was valued at USD 4.18 billion in 2024 and is projected to grow to USD 4.46 billion in 2025, with a CAGR of 6.90%, reaching USD 6.24 billion by 2030.

Key Segmentation Insights in the Blood Collection Tubes Industry
A detailed examination of the market reveals a comprehensive segmentation that underpins current industry trends and offers insights into emerging opportunities. One of the primary approaches involves analyzing product characteristics based on tube types, which include formulations for Citrate Tubes, EDTA Tubes, Glucose Tubes, Heparin Tubes, Plasma Separation Tubes (PST), and Serum Separation Tubes (SST). This nuanced perspective allows for a better understanding of how specific tubes are engineered to cater to different diagnostic and clinical requirements. Additionally, an evaluation based on material composition distinguishes between Glass Tubes and Plastic Tubes, with each category presenting unique advantages such as durability, cost efficiency, and compatibility with automated systems.
The market further classifies applications by exploring diverse usage scenarios in clinical settings. The overall analysis delves into vital areas such as Blood Banking, where reliability and consistency are crucial, as well as Clinical Diagnostics, Forensic applications, Molecular Diagnostics, and Research & Development. This framework aids in identifying sector-specific trends and highlights the varying degrees of demand based on technological sophistication and application requirements. Moreover, a thorough understanding of the market is achieved by considering the end-user segments, which primarily encompass Blood Banks, Diagnostic Laboratories, Home Care Settings, Hospitals, and Research Institutions. By weaving together these layers of segmentation, stakeholders gain a multi-dimensional view of the market, enabling them to tailor strategies that address both current and future needs.
